Points system seems really flawed

St Marks beats Middletown and both teams get 2 points
Losing teams should not get the same points as the team that beat them
Bonus points should always be less then points for winning a game

St Marks and Sallies split games
Sallies gets 6 points
St Marks gets 4

St Marks and St Es split games
St Es gets 6 points
St Marks gets 4 again

Both 9 loss teams Sallies and St Es get byes while 15-5 St Marks has play in game

Mik, I was at that Howard - St E.'s game. If memory serves me correctly, Jareem Dowling and Carlos Hawkins had transferred to Howard from Tatnall going from 10th to 11th grade. DSSAA had instituted a rule that year that if you were living away from your home you needed to be with a legal guardian and the guardianship papers had to be in the school files. Suffice it to say that the guardianship papers were not in the files and Howard had to forfeit like their first 7-8 games. What is interesting is that Howard could probably lied and got away with it.

St. E's outplayed Howard and deserved to win that night at Glasgow. The next year, Howard made it to the field house. The game that got them there was beating Sussex Tech at Polytech. In that game Carlos Hawkins outdueled Brian Polk...it went down to the wire.
